Subject: Re: [PATCH v4 0/3] vfio/pci: Introduce vfio_pci driver for ISM devices

> >> Hi all,
> >> 
> >> This series adds a vfio_pci variant driver for the s390-specific
> >> Internal Shared Memory (ISM) devices used for inter-VM communication
> >> including SMC-D.
> >> 
> >> This is a prerequisite for an in-development open-source user space
> >> driver stack that will allow to use ISM devices to provide remote
> >> console and block device functionality. This stack will be part of
> >> s390-tools.
> >> 
> >> This driver would also allow QEMU to mediate access to an ISM device,
> >> enabling a form of PCI pass-through even for guests whose hardware
> >> cannot directly execute PCI accesses, such as nested guests.
> >> 
> >> On s390, kernel primitives such as ioread() and iowrite() are switched
> >> over from function handle based PCI load/stores instructions to PCI
> >> memory-I/O (MIO) loads/stores when these are available and not
> >> explicitly disabled. Since these instructions cannot be used with ISM
> >> devices, ensure that classic function handle-based PCI instructions are
> >> used instead.
> >> 
> >> The driver is still required even when MIO instructions are disabled, as
> >> the ISM device relies on the PCI store‑block (PCISTB) instruction to
> >> perform write operations.
> >>

> >> Changes in v4:
> >> - Fix bug with < 8 byte reads. For code simplicity, only support 8 byte reads.  
> >
> > Does the ISM device define sub-8-byte accesses as valid?  It looks like
> > if pread() doesn't return the desired size QEMU will fill the return
> > with -1.  Unless such accesses are classified as undefined by ISM,
> > doesn't that suggest a potential data corruption issue to the guest
> > driver?  Thanks,
> >
> > Alex  
> 
> Hi Alex,
> 
> thanks for the quick feedback!
> 
> We are currently developing this extension for a non‑QEMU vfio user space
> driver. Reads smaller than 8 bytes are theoretically valid, but they are not
> used by this driver nor the existing in-kernel driver at the moment. We could
> extend this in the future if needed.
> 
> vfio‑pci based PCI pass-through of the ISM device is already possible without
> this extension. In that case, the ISM driver in the guest kernel accesses the
> BARs directly through hardware virtualization, without using the new access
> routines provided by this variant driver.

Hi Julian,

The cover letter argues a secondary use case with QEMU, especially in a
nested environment.  The ISM range appears to be an interface to a
variety of device types, console and block are noted.  It's also noted
in the implementation that the z/Architecture allows sub-8-byte access.

I think we need to be cautious that the existence of this driver makes
it available for use with QEMU and other VMMs.  In the case of QEMU
vfio_region_ops will allow single-byte access by default.

The restricted access width is positioned as a simplification here, but
it needs to be evaluated against all the use cases.  Unless we're 100%
sure none of those use cases rely on sub-8-byte accesses, we might be
setting ourselves up for hacks later to fix or detect partial access
support.

I'll leave it to IBM folks to determine if this is indeed a
simplification for long term support of all use cases and not a short
term fix for the short term use case.  Thanks,

Alex
